How much does webtoon pay per 1000 views?

Webtoon creators typically earn between $1 to $3 per 1,000 views through the platform's ad revenue sharing program. Earnings can vary based on factors such as audience engagement, region, and whether the creator participates in monetization features like paid episodes or merchandise. Consistent quality content and building a large, engaged readership can increase potential earnings for webtoon artists and creators.

What is Webtoon Entertainment and what do they do?

Webtoon Entertainment is a digital entertainment company best known for its web-based comics platform, WEBTOON. They produce, publish, and distribute a wide variety of webcomics and graphic stories, connecting creators with a global audience. The company supports both established and aspiring creators, offering a platform for storytelling in genres like romance, fantasy, action, and more. Webtoon Entertainment also collaborates with partners to adapt popular webcomics into TV series, movies, and other media. Their mission is to revolutionize how comics are created, shared, and enjoyed worldwide.

WEBTOON Entertainment is a leading global entertainment company and home to some of the world's largest storytelling platforms. As the global leader and pioneer of the mobile webcomic format, WEBTOON Entertainment has transformed comics and visual storytelling for fans and creators.
With its CANVAS UGC platform empowering anyone to become a creator, and a growing roster of superstar WEBTOON Originals creators and series, WEBTOON Entertainment's passionate fandoms are the new face of pop culture. WEBTOON Entertainment adaptations are available on Netflix, Prime Video, Crunchyroll, and other screens around the world, and the company's content partners include Discord, HYBE, and DC Comics, among many others.

With approximately 155 million monthly active users, WEBTOON Entertainment's IP & Creator Ecosystem of aligned brands and platforms include WEBTOON, Wattpad--the world's leading webnovel platform--WEBTOON Productions, Studio N, Studio LICO, WEBTOON Unscrolled, LINE MANGA, and eBookJapan, among others.
